    Well, I'm not the botanist that some of these guys are, but those roots look killer to me. Nice bright white.

    As far as you having balls (on the plant)he he I can't tell by that pic. It's a good close up with good focus, but usually in picture form, it's easier for your audience to see if the ball or pistil(s) are shown going from left to right, or right to left. But a "straight-on" view like that makes it tough for us to tell.

    If your at this point now, just wait a few more days, ,and you should easily see pistils or more balls.
